What Are Water and Riparian Rights?
Water and riparian rights refer to the rights of landowners to make use of any bodies of water that border their properties. This includes using the water for:
- Natural uses like drinking, watering, and agricultural irrigation
- Recreational uses like boating, fishing, and swimming
- Commercial uses like crossing into navigable waters and building piers and docks
What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need a Water and Riparian Rights Lawyer?
You should contact a water rights lawyer promptly if you are dealing with water or riparian rights disputes, such as other property owners:
- Redirecting the flow of water upstream from your property
- Polluting or draining water
- Obstructing the waterway or illegally dumping into the water
How Can a Water and Riparian Rights Lawyer Help Me?
Water laws vary by state. While some states require property owners to use water “reasonably” or “proportionately,” other states follow an “appropriative rights” principle that allows landowners to do more with water for agricultural purposes. A lawyer can review your situation, ensure you are following the law, and represent you in a dispute with other property owners or governmental bodies.
